| Category / Metric | Memphis | Oceanside |
|---|---|---|
| Financial Overview | ||
| Median Income | $51,399 | $99,108 |
| Unemployment Rate | 3% | 5% |
| Housing Market | ||
| Median Home Price | $199,950 | $880,000 |
| Price per SqFt | $127 | $539 |
| Monthly Rent (1BR) | $1,146 | $2,174 |
| Housing Cost Index | 77.5 | 185.8 |
| Cost of Living | ||
| Groceries Index | 94.8 | 103.5 |
| Gas Price (Gallon) | $3.40 | $3.98 |
| Safety & Lifestyle | ||
| Violent Crime (per 100k) | 1901.0 | 499.5 |
| Bachelor's Degree+ | 29% | 34% |
| Air Quality (AQI) | 35 | 51 |
Memphis is 17% cheaper overall than Oceanside.
Expect lower salaries in Memphis (-48% vs Oceanside).
Rent is much more affordable in Memphis (47% lower).
Memphis has a higher violent crime rate (281% higher).

Memphis: The Grit & Grind
Memphis is a city with a heartbeat you can feel. It’s not trying to be polished or perfect. It’s the home of Elvis’s Graceland, the National Civil Rights Museum, and the best BBQ you’ll ever eat. The vibe is unapologetically Southern—friendly, slow-paced in the neighborhoods, but with a thriving downtown and a booming music and tech scene. It’s a city for those who appreciate history, value community, and want a place where you can make a real impact without fighting for every inch of space. It’s for the artist, the entrepreneur, the family looking for roots.
Oceanside: The Coastal Dream
Oceanside is the quintessential SoCal beach town, but without the insane price tag of its neighbors like Encinitas or La Jolla. Life here revolves around the ocean: surfing at dawn, sunset strolls on the pier, and a generally relaxed, healthy lifestyle. It’s less about fast-paced career climbing and more about work-life balance. It’s a haven for military families (Camp Pendleton is next door), outdoor enthusiasts, and anyone who defines "quality of life" by the number of days you can wear shorts. It’s for the laid-back professional, the active retiree, the family that prioritizes outdoor living.
Verdict: If you crave culture, history, and a lower cost of living, Memphis is your spot. If your dream is to hear the ocean from your bedroom window and you’re okay with paying for the privilege, Oceanside calls your name.

Memphis: A Buyer’s Market (for now)
The median home price in Memphis is a breath of fresh air: $199,950. You can find a solid 3-bedroom, 2-bath home for under $250,000. The market is competitive but not cutthroat; you have time to make a decision. Renting is also an affordable entry point, giving you flexibility. However, inventory is moving, and prices are slowly rising as the city’s economy grows. It’s a stable, accessible market for first-time buyers.
Oceanside: A Seller’s Market on Steroids
With a median home price of $880,000, Oceanside is in a different universe. The California housing crisis is real. This is a hyper-competitive seller’s market, often with bidding wars, all-cash offers, and waived contingencies. Even a modest starter home will push you over the $700k mark. Renting is the only viable option for most, but even that is expensive. The barrier to entry for homeownership is astronomical unless you’re coming with significant equity or a very high income.
Verdict: If your goal is to own a home without draining your life savings, Memphis is the clear winner. Oceanside’s market is for those with deep pockets or who prioritize the location above all else.

For a family looking to buy a home, build equity, and have a lower cost of living, Memphis is the smarter choice. The affordability allows for more disposable income for education, activities, and savings. While crime is a concern, there are safe, family-friendly suburbs (like Germantown or Collierville) within the metro area. You can own a big house with a yard for a fraction of what it would cost in Oceanside.
For a young professional with a high-earning career (especially in tech, biotech, or remote work), Oceanside offers an unbeatable quality of life. The weather, outdoor activities, and social scene are perfect for an active lifestyle. The higher income required is manageable for those in lucrative fields, and the networking opportunities in the broader San Diego area are immense. The trade-off is less savings and higher stress about housing costs.
Oceanside is a retiree’s dream. The perfect climate means no shoveling snow or battling oppressive summer heat. The beach, parks, and active community are ideal for a healthy, engaged retirement. While the cost of living is high, many retirees come with equity from selling homes in even more expensive markets. The peace of mind from lower crime rates is also a major plus. Memphis is affordable, but the weather and crime can be challenging for retirees.
